REE Automotive Q4 2024 Earnings Call Summary

1Key Financial Results and Metrics

Liquidity: Improved to $72 million by year-end, including an $18 million credit facility.

Capital Raises: Approximately $60 million raised through two registered securities offerings in 2024.

Net Loss:

GAAP net loss for 2024 was $111.8 million, slightly improved from $114.2 million in 2023.

Non-GAAP net loss improved to $70.3 million from $98.3 million in 2023.

Q4 2024 GAAP net loss was $37.3 million, a slight improvement from $38.5 million in Q3 2024.

Q4 2024 non-GAAP net loss was $19.8 million, up from $16.8 million in Q3 2024.

Cash Burn: Expected cash burn for Q1 2025 is projected at $18 million to $20 million, with plans to reduce operational expenses from $6 million to $4 million monthly by year-end.

2Strategic Updates and Business Highlights

Technology Milestones: Achieved first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ard certification for a full-by-wire vehicle in the U.S. and completed an autonomous drive on an active runway with Airbus.

Software Initiatives: Launched REEai Cloud in collaboration with Geotab, aiming to generate new software revenue opportunities through vehicle services and advanced data analytics.

Production Plans: Advanced production of certain vehicles and solidified order books, including a significant non-binding MoU for technology integration into autonomous shuttles.

Focus Shift: Emphasizing a transition to a software-driven business model, with plans to license technology and pursue a subscription-based revenue model.

3Forward Guidance and Outlook

Production Pause: Temporarily pausing vehicle production due to uncertainties around U.S. tariffs and trade policies, with plans to reassess production once conditions stabilize.

Cost Reduction Strategy: Significant reduction in operational costs and headcount adjustments planned to improve financial flexibility.

Revenue Generation: Focus on generating revenue through software offerings while evaluating macroeconomic conditions.

4Bad News, Challenges, or Points of Concern

Tariff Impact: Current U.S. tariffs and trade policies have created significant challenges for the supply chain and production plans.

Growing Concern: Management expressed substantial doubt about the company's ability to continue as a growing concern over the next 12 months due to the macroeconomic environment.

Cash Flow Risks: The ability to raise debt has been impacted, affecting revenue forecasts and operational capabilities.

5Notable Q&A Insights

MoU Status: No changes anticipated in the timeline for converting the MoU to a definitive agreement; payments have already begun.

Cash Position: Q1 cash balance (excluding the credit facility) is $61 million.

Reservation Book: Demand remains strong with nearly $1 billion in reservations, although the temporary production pause may affect delivery timelines.

Focus on Software: Management is shifting focus to software and technology solutions as a response to current production challenges, indicating a strategic pivot to less capital-intensive business models.
